Essential Tools for Pumpkin Decorating

Before diving into the decorating ideas, it’s important to gather the right tools. Here are the essentials:

  • **Pumpkins**: Choose a medium-sized pumpkin for easy handling.
  • **Carving Set**: Includes a small saw, scoop, and carving tools.
  • **Paint and Brushes**: Acrylic paint works great for colorful designs.
  • **Stencils**: Utilize nurse-themed stencils for easy decoration.
  • **Hot Glue Gun**: For attaching embellishments such as fabric or accessories.
  • **Markers**: For sketching your designs before cutting or painting.

Basic Pumpkin Decorating Techniques

Whether you prefer carving or painting, here are some basic techniques to get you started:

Carving

For those who love a challenge, carving can create spectacular designs. Here’s how:

  1. Cut off the top of the pumpkin and scoop out the insides.
  2. Draw your design on the pumpkin using a marker.
  3. Carefully carve out the design with carving tools.

Painting

If carving isn’t your thing, painting is a fantastic alternative:

  1. Clean the pumpkin’s surface.
  2. Prime it with a base coat if desired.
  3. Use brushes to paint your design, layering as needed.

Now for the fun part! Here are ten creative nurse pumpkin decorating ideas to inspire you:

1. Nurse Scrubs Pumpkin

Paint your pumpkin in nurse scrub colors, complete with pockets. Use fabric to create scrub-like pockets and add small instruments inside, like a toy syringe or stethoscope.

2. Band-Aid Pumpkin

Cover your pumpkin with Band-Aid designs made from beige paint or stickers to simulate a giant Band-Aid. Add a cheerful smile to complete the look.

3. Stethoscope Pumpkin

Paint the pumpkin black and fashion a stethoscope out of black pipe cleaners. Attach it to the pumpkin and paint the end pieces in silver.

4. Medical Chart Pumpkin

Create a pumpkin that resembles a medical chart. Paint the pumpkin white and use black paint or markers to write “patient information” along with funny medical notes.

5. Heartbeat Pumpkin

With red and black paint, create an EKG line across the pumpkin. Highlight the heart aspect with extra red paint to form a heart shape.

6. Nurse with a Cap Pumpkin

Use white paper or fabric to create a nurse’s cap that fits atop the pumpkin. Paint a smiley face to embody a friendly nurse design.

7. IV Drip Pumpkin

Dress your pumpkin like a patient. Attach clear tubing and a bag (use a small clear plastic bag filled with colored water) to create an IV drip effect.

FAQs about Nurse Pumpkin Decorating Ideas

What are some easy pumpkin decorating ideas for nurses?

Easy ideas include painting a pumpkin to look like a Band-Aid or using fabric to create nurse scrubs and pockets.

Can I use real pumpkins for decorating?

Yes, real pumpkins are great for traditional carving. However, if you want longevity, consider using faux pumpkins.

How can I make my pumpkin decorations last longer?

Pumpkin preservative sprays can help maintain the integrity of carved pumpkins, and painted pumpkins last longer without rotting.

Are there nurse-themed pumpkin stencils available?

Yes, there are many free templates available online that feature nurse and medical-themed designs suitable for pumpkin carving.

What do I do with my pumpkin after Halloween?

If it’s a real pumpkin, consider composting it or using it in recipes. Faux pumpkins can be saved for next year’s decoration.
